Two medical students killed in motorcycle accident in Birgunj



BIRGUNJ: Two youths, who were pursuing their studies in medicine in Birgunj, Parsa, lost their lives in a motorcycle accident.

According to the police, the accident occurred at Birgunj-15, claiming the lives of two students enrolled in the MBBS program at Birgunj National Medical College.

The deceased individuals have been identified as 23-year-old Sumit Yadav from Dhanusha and 23-year-old Sanchit Yadav from Bara.

DSP Kumar Bikram Thapa informed that both victims were second-year MBBS students.

Authorities suspect that the motorcycle accident may have resulted from excessive speed.

The bodies of the two youths are currently at Narayani Hospital for post-mortem examinations, with ongoing investigations by the police into the incident.
